Engineering colleges offer specialized courses in various branches such as Computer Science, Civil, Mechanical, Electrical, and more. These programs typically last 4 years and focus on technical education and innovation.
Students gain hands-on experience through labs, projects, and internships, preparing them for careers in engineering, technology, and research fields.
Students must have completed their 10+2 education with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ics as core subjects and qualify through entrance exams like JEE, state-level tests, or university-specific exams.
Engineering graduates can work in sectors like IT, manufacturing, research, construction, and automation.
